Aujourd'hui, Telegram est bien plus qu'un simple messager. C'est une véritable plateforme qui permet aux entreprises et aux développeurs de créer et d'utiliser des applications web qui fonctionnent directement au sein du messager. Ces webapps permettent une interaction directe avec les utilisateurs et offrent divers services sans avoir besoin de télécharger des programmes supplémentaires. Dans cet article, nous, AdsGram, expliquerons ce qu'est une application web, comment en créer une et comment la lancer efficacement sur Telegram.
Pourquoi l'Application Web Telegram est pratique et comment elle fonctionne
L'Application Web Telegram est effectivement un outil pratique, tant pour les entreprises que pour les utilisateurs, car elle simplifie grandement l'accès aux services. Vous pouvez également lancer des mini-apps (TMA) via l'Application Web Telegram pour les placements publicitaires. Explorons pourquoi c'est le cas et comment fonctionnent exactement les Applications Web Telegram.
Accès instantané sans actions superflues
Un des principaux avantages de l'Application Web Telegram est sa capacité à se lancer directement au sein du messager. Cela signifie que les utilisateurs n'ont pas besoin de télécharger et d'installer des applications supplémentaires ni de naviguer vers des sites externes — tout se déroule dans l'interface familière de Telegram. Il suffit de cliquer sur un bouton spécial dans la conversation, et l'application s'ouvrira instantanément dans le navigateur de Telegram. Cela fait gagner du temps et simplifie l'accès, ce qui est particulièrement important dans le monde d'aujourd'hui où la rapidité est primordiale.
Interactivité et interaction en temps réel
Dans l'Application Web Telegram, vous pouvez créer une interface qui réagit aux actions des utilisateurs en temps réel. Par exemple, s'il s'agit d'une boutique en ligne, un acheteur potentiel peut facilement parcourir les produits, les ajouter à son panier et passer une commande sans quitter le messager. Tout fonctionne rapidement et sans accroc, car l'application se charge instantanément, en utilisant les ressources de Telegram.
De plus, les Applications Web Telegram peuvent interagir avec des bots, envoyant et recevant des données. Cela permet de créer des systèmes complexes qui peuvent répondre aux demandes des utilisateurs, fournir des offres personnalisées et gérer des données en fonction des actions des utilisateurs. Par exemple, dans les services de réservation, un bot peut automatiquement envoyer une confirmation ou un rappel concernant une réservation, rendant l'interaction encore plus confortable.
Capacités d'intégration étendues
Les Telegram Web Apps vont au-delà des fonctionnalités simples. Les développeurs peuvent tirer parti de l'API Telegram pour s'intégrer à d'autres services et données. Par exemple, si vous souhaitez créer un tableau de bord affichant les taux de change, la météo ou d'autres statistiques, vous pouvez connecter des données provenant de sources externes et les mettre à jour directement dans le messager. Cela rend le Telegram Web App un outil polyvalent pour fournir des informations et des services à jour.
Facilité d'utilisation et de navigation
L'interface des Telegram Web Apps peut être personnalisée pour être intuitive pour les utilisateurs. Par exemple, il existe une option pour ajouter des boutons de navigation menant à différentes pages de l'application ou utiliser des pop-ups et des contrôles pour simplifier l'achèvement des tâches. Telegram prend en charge l'intégration avec CSS et JavaScript, permettant aux développeurs de créer une interface simple et conviviale adaptée aux besoins des utilisateurs.
Aucune installation ni mise à jour requise
Contrairement aux applications mobiles traditionnelles, les Telegram Web Apps n'ont pas besoin d'être téléchargées ou installées. Elles fonctionnent en tant que services web et se mettent automatiquement à jour lorsque le développeur apporte des modifications. Cela permet aux entreprises et aux développeurs d'économiser du temps et des ressources sur la maintenance et les mises à jour, tandis que les utilisateurs ont toujours accès à la dernière version du service sans avoir besoin de mettre manuellement à jour l'application.
Exemples
Maintenant que vous comprenez comment fonctionne le Telegram Web App et pourquoi il est pratique, explorons quelques exemples d'applications qui peuvent être créées :
- Magasins en ligne. Une personne peut entrer dans le magasin directement dans le chat, choisir des produits, les ajouter au panier et passer une commande. Le paiement peut également se faire au sein du messager, simplifiant le processus et le rendant aussi rapide que possible.
- Services de réservation. Le Telegram Web App est parfait pour les services où des réservations sont nécessaires - que ce soit une table dans un restaurant, une chambre d'hôtel ou un billet pour un événement. L'utilisateur peut sélectionner l'heure et la date, faire une réservation et recevoir une confirmation via le bot.
- Applications financières. Sur Telegram, vous pouvez créer une application pour suivre vos dépenses ou gérer vos comptes bancaires. Telegram Web App vous permet d'afficher des données en toute sécurité et de gérer vos finances en utilisant les API et les fonctionnalités de sécurité de la plateforme.
- Plateformes éducatives et cours. Sur Telegram, vous pouvez développer une application pour l'apprentissage, où les utilisateurs passeront des tests, regarderont des leçons vidéo et réaliseront des devoirs directement dans le chat.
La possibilité de lancer des applications au sein du messager, d'utiliser les données des bots et de s'intégrer à des services externes ouvre de vastes opportunités pour les entreprises et les développeurs. Avec cette approche, les utilisateurs accèdent à tous les services nécessaires au même endroit, tandis que les entreprises peuvent facilement créer et maintenir leurs applications sans quitter l'écosystème Telegram.
Comment créer une Telegram Web App ?
Passons maintenant à la partie la plus importante — comment créer votre propre application web pour Telegram. C'est un processus intéressant et simple si vous savez par où commencer. Examinons de plus près chaque étape afin que vous puissiez naviguer en toute confiance de l'idée à une application entièrement fonctionnelle.
Étape #1. Création d'un bot
Nous commençons par un bot. C'est l'outil principal par lequel les gens interagiront avec votre application. Pour le créer, nous utilisons @BotFather — le bot officiel de Telegram qui vous aide à configurer rapidement un nouveau bot. Il vous suffit de suivre les instructions, d'inventer un nom et d'obtenir le token API dont vous aurez besoin pour connecter votre bot à l'application. C'est comme une clé qui permet au bot et à l'application de 'parler' entre eux.
Étape #2. Développement de l'application web
Maintenant, nous passons à la création de l'application web elle-même. La bonne nouvelle est que vous pouvez utiliser des outils de développement web standards tels que HTML, CSS et JavaScript. Telegram Web App ne nécessite pas de langages de programmation complexes ou spécifiques — si vous savez comment créer des sites web, vous le ferez facilement.
Vous pouvez créer une application web à partir de zéro ou utiliser des modèles et bibliothèques prêts à l'emploi qui accéléreront le développement. Par exemple, vous pouvez prendre un modèle pour un magasin en ligne, un chat ou tout autre service et l'adapter à vos besoins. L'essentiel est de s'assurer que l'interface est simple et claire pour les utilisateurs, car ils interagiront directement avec l'application dans le chat.
Étape #3. Intégrer l'application Web avec le Bot
Une fois votre application prête, vous devez la "mettre en relation" avec le bot. Pour ce faire, vous devrez ajouter un bouton dans l'interface du bot qui lancera votre application web. Par exemple, cela pourrait être un bouton "Lancer" qui ouvre directement votre webapp dans la conversation lorsqu'on clique dessus.
L'intégration se fait via l'API Telegram — un ensemble d'outils qui vous permet de configurer comment le bot et l'application interagissent. Vous ajoutez un bouton dans le code du bot et spécifiez le lien vers votre application (URL) afin que, lorsqu'il est cliqué, ce lien s'ouvre dans le messager. De cette façon, les utilisateurs qui cliquent sur le bouton sont directement dirigés vers votre application sans quitter Telegram.
Étape #4. Déployer l'application Web
Maintenant que tout est prêt, vous devez héberger votre application sur un serveur afin qu'elle soit accessible aux utilisateurs. C'est une étape nécessaire, car l'application Web Telegram ne fonctionne que si elle dispose d'une URL pouvant être ouverte. Voici ce que vous devez faire :
- Choisissez un fournisseur d'hébergement. Vous pouvez utiliser n'importe quel service d'hébergement qui prend en charge HTTPS (c'est une exigence pour fonctionner avec Telegram). Des plateformes populaires comme Heroku, Vercel ou Firebase sont adaptées, vous permettant de déployer des petits projets gratuitement et fournissant HTTPS par défaut.
- Téléchargez vos fichiers d'application. Transférez votre code (HTML, CSS, JS) sur le serveur afin que l'application soit accessible à une adresse spécifique (URL). Assurez-vous que l'application fonctionne correctement et se charge sans erreurs.
- Configurez votre domaine et HTTPS. Si vous utilisez votre propre domaine, veillez à connecter un certificat SSL afin que votre site fonctionne sur HTTPS. Ce n'est pas seulement une exigence obligatoire de Telegram, mais aussi une mesure importante pour protéger les données des utilisateurs.
- Testez l'application. Ouvrez l'URL de votre application web dans un navigateur et assurez-vous que tout fonctionne comme prévu. Vérifiez comment l'application s'ouvre via votre bot dans Telegram — tout doit se charger rapidement et sans accroc.
Et quelques conseils utiles :
- Testez votre application à chaque étape pour éviter les erreurs. Il est préférable de la vérifier à la fois dans le navigateur et sur Telegram pour s'assurer que tout fonctionne correctement.
- Profitez des bibliothèques et des outils prêts à l'emploi, tels que l'API Web App de Telegram, pour simplifier le processus d'intégration et ajouter des éléments interactifs avec lesquels les utilisateurs peuvent interagir dans le chat.
- Personnalisez l'interface pour les appareils mobiles, car la plupart des utilisateurs de Telegram y accèdent depuis leurs téléphones. Il est important que tout soit bien présenté et fonctionne correctement sur un petit écran.
Intégration et promotion de l'application Web de Telegram avec AdsGram
Avec AdsGram, le processus de création et de lancement de votre application Web Telegram devient plus simple et plus efficace. Notre plateforme ne vous aide pas seulement à créer et à lier l'application web à votre bot, mais la promeut également efficacement sur Telegram. AdsGram fournit des outils pour la configuration et le ciblage des annonces, vous permettant de montrer votre application à ceux qui sont vraiment intéressés par vos services.
De plus, AdsGram propose des outils d'analyse pratiques pour suivre comment les utilisateurs interagissent avec votre application et améliorer votre service en fonction de ces données. Avec nous, vous pouvez attirer une audience plus rapidement et augmenter vos revenus grâce à votre application Web Telegram !





